Fast bowler Ihsanullah left for medical checkup to UK

Fast bowler Ihsanullah has left Pakistan for the UK for further medical treatment as he rehabilitates from a long-term elbow injury, reported 24NewsHD TV channel on Sunday.

According to PCB, Ihsanullah departed for Manchester, England, early on Sunday to make the critical medical consultation on Monday with renowned orthopedic surgeon Professor Adam Watts to discuss his elbow issue.

Professor Watts is an expert in sports injuries, trauma surgery, shoulder and elbow treatments, and hand and wrist surgery.

Multan Sultans, the team Ihsanullah associated with, worked with the PCB to get this appointment.

The PCB will pay for Ihsanullah's medical care and rehabilitation costs in its capacity as his parent organization.

“Further updates will be provided by the PCB following Professor Watts' assessment and diagnosis.”

The 21-year-old Ihsanullah has only played five international matches for Pakistan, his most recent appearance was against New Zealand in April 2023.
